Replacement method
(1) Get a container for oil drain on hand, and put the tip of the drain
tube into the container.
(2) Turn the oil drain cock through 90 degrees, and the oil will start
draining. Opening the oil inlet during draining can drain oil fast.
(3) After all the oil has been drained, close the oil drain cock by
setting it back in the initial place.
(4) Supply oil by following the same procedure as for
replenishment.
CAUTION
After replacing the turbo blower oil, perform
discharge aging.
